Understanding Prescription Drug Discounts for Seniors
As the cost of healthcare continues to rise, especially for seniors, understanding options for prescription drug discounts has become increasingly vital. State officials will be convening at the Ansonia Senior Center to discuss various programs and resources designed to help reduce medication expenses for older adults in the community. Programs like Medicare and Medicaid serve as essential pillars in ensuring that seniors receive the medical care they need without breaking the bank. These programs are instrumental in preventing financial burdens that can arise from high prescription drug prices, allowing seniors to focus on their health rather than worrying about costs.
